Electric specialists are usually identified by three significant sorts of job carried out. "Outdoors" or "line" contractors are accountable for high-voltage power transmission and distribution lines. Line contractors build and keep the facilities called for to move power produced at a nuclear power plant through a series of high-voltage lines and substations before it is utilized to power centers, structures, and homes.

NECA publishes a market publication, and sponsors a yearly convention and trade convention. Independent Electric Specialists (IEC) is an additional profession association for electrical specialists with 70 phases throughout the united state. They offer education and learning and training through a United State Department of Labor recognized apprenticeship program. The International League of Electric Employees organizes and represents over 700,000 members, and supplies training and apprenticeship programs.
The NEC is a commonly embraced model code for the installation of electric components and systems, developed to safeguard persons and residential or commercial property from threats emerging from making use of electricity. While these are the default minimum needs and guidelines, some states change picked locations of the NEC code to suit their details circumstances.

Electrical contractors, on the various other hand, are competent tradespeople who carry out hands-on electrical services, such as circuitry, repair services, and troubleshooting. They frequently work under an electrical specialist or as independent professionals. If you're hiring, consider your demands: for tiny household repair work, an independent electrical expert may be sufficient, however, for massive tasks, new installations, or compliance-heavy work, hiring an electrical contracting company makes certain every little thing runs smoothly from beginning to end.
